NEWARK – Bree Moffett started the game with black kinesiology tape on her right quadricep, one strip down and three across. She hit the turf at Rullo Stadium time and again, her stick in constant entanglement with the opposition.
She kept getting up – with an occasional wobble or limp – and she kept playing. The game didn't end on schedule. Her Smyrna Eagles and the perennial powerhouse Cape Henlopen Vikings played to a 0-0 draw over the 60 regulation minutes of the DIAA Division I field hockey title game and its first 10-minute sudden-death overtime period.
